  • Q: How to reseal the windshield on 2005 Ford Focus?
    A: The windshield resealing procedure starts by removing the cowl panel grille before dismantling the left-hand (LH) A-pillar trim panel and right-hand (RH) A-pillar trim panel. When present in the vehicle you need to extract the overhead console and interior lamp while disconnecting their electrical connectors when necessary. Proceed to remove screws and sun visors after opening their covering faces while disengaging their retaining clips. Remove the LH and RH assist handles by opening the covers then rotating their retaining clips 90 degrees. The front portion of the headliner needs to be lowered partially before finding suitable support material. Apply non-alcohol based glass cleaner to clean both inside and outside regions of the windshield glass. A correctly cut urethane adhesive tip should go into a high-ratio electric or battery-operated caulk gun to apply the urethane adhesive so that all gaps become a single continuous bead. Place urethane adhesive on windshield sides and top inside the car while applying it to the bottom outside the vehicle. Perform a minimum one-hour cure test for the urethane adhesive followed by a leak test to determine more urethane adhesive application. Once the urethane adhesive cures you should move the front headliner section into position and you can put back the left hand and right hand assist handles by twisting their retaining clips and cover both assist handles. Affix the LH and RH sun visor retaining clips followed by screw installation of the visors and reinstallation of interior lamps together with electrical connector connection, if present. The installation process ends with reattaching overhead console and cowl panel grille along with the LH and RH A-pillar trim panels.
